Tenet Healthcare Corporation THC is again making headlines with its development on the previously announced collaboration with the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Texas (BCBSTX). The collaborating entities have made their first move toward implementing the Accountable Care Organization ACO by extending their contract for a multi-year period.
This ACO, which is an outcome of the collaboration between BCBSTX and Tenet Healthcare's clinically integrated organizations in Texas, will expectedly be launched on Jan 1, 2015. The motive behind the formation of the statewide ACO is to bring in healthcare providers from Tenet Healthcare's Texas markets to deliver high-quality value-based care to BCBSTX members. This is aimed to be done by improving coordination among physicians and reducing unnecessary hospital admissions, readmissions, ER visits and duplication of services.
While announcing the collaboration in Nov 2013, it was stated that the agreement could be extended to incorporate health insurance marketplace patients over the life of the agreement. Along with the aforementioned long-term contract extension, BCBSTX members will be consistently provided an in-network access to Tenet Healthcare's hospitals and outpatient centers at Texas. This, in turn, should help Tenet Healthcare to generate more revenues.
Health care providers voluntarily form alliances to establish ACOs to provide coordinated high quality care to patients at lower costs. Tenet Healthcare has been forming ACOs with a number of organizations for quite some time to enhance patient care in the U.S. Earlier this month, the company inked a collaborative Accountable Care deal with the Blue Cross and Blue Shield company of Florida, named Florida Blue. Tenet Healthcare presently operates 12 ACOs in nine states.
Other healthcare stocks that have formed ACOs in recent times include Humana Inc. HUM and Aetna Inc. AET. While Aetna formed an ACO with Northeast Medical Group, Inc. (“NEMG”) in Connecticut on May 1, Humana formed an Accountable Care relation with Mercy in Apr 2014. These ACOs or collaborative accountable cares are a means of working toward improving the health of all Americans, in consistence with President Obama's policies.
